Rebekah Taylor is a Private Client Executive in the Wills, Trusts and Probate department at Harold G Walker Solicitors, based in the Wimborne office. She joined the firm in October 2024, bringing with her several years of experience in Private Client work.
Rebekah specialises in Wills, Powers of Attorney and Estate Administration. She is known for her empathetic and client-focused approach and is committed to providing clear, practical and compassionate support, particularly when clients and their families are navigating difficult or sensitive circumstances.
Rebekah also assists clients with Emergency Wills and Lasting Powers of Attorney, recognising the importance of accessible legal advice when urgent or unforeseen circumstances arise. At her discretion, she offers appointments outside of office hours; to help ensure clients can access the advice and support they need when it matters most.
Before joining Harold G Walker, Rebekah worked as a Private Client Paralegal at a local law firm, where she developed her experience in estate planning and probate matters. Prior to this, she worked in Management of Affairs and Court of Protection matters, gaining experience in supporting vulnerable individuals and their families and developing a strong understanding of the particular care and sensitivity these matters require.
Rebekah holds an LLB Law degree and an LLM in International Law from the University of Lincoln. She is currently working towards qualification as a solicitor through the SQE route, further developing her legal knowledge and professional expertise. She is also a Student Member of the Association of Lifetime Lawyers, reflecting her particular interest in supporting clients with later-life legal matters and her commitment to continuing professional development within the Private Client sector.
Alongside her professional work, Rebekah was elected Charities Officer for the Bournemouth and District Junior Lawyers Division for the 2025/2026 year, demonstrating her commitment to supporting the local legal community and charitable initiatives. She is also a Committee Member of the Dorset Law Society.
